Abstract

This thesis explores Digitalization of the insurance sector in Algeria Implementation, challenges, and Issues, through a case study of Algeria FinLab, a key actor in supporting digital innovation across the national market. The central research question asks: How is digitalization evolving in Algeria’s insurance industry, and what role can innovation platforms like Algeria FinLab play in enhancing service quality? The study aims to analyze the current state of digitalization, identify the organizational and technical barriers hindering its progress, and assess future opportunities from the perspective of sector stakeholders. The theoretical framework examines the technical and organizational dimensions of digitalization within institutions, with a specific focus on the insurance sector, which depends heavily on data processing and remote service delivery. Methodologically, the research follows a qualitative approach involving document analysis, semi-structured interviews with representatives from the UAR and SAA, and field observations conducted during an internship. The findings highlight that digital transformation has become a strategic necessity. However, its implementation in Algeria remains constrained by weak infrastructure, outdated legal frameworks, and a shortage of digital expertise. The study concludes with several recommendations, including legal modernization, structured digital training, partnerships with InsurTech platforms, and strengthening the strategic role of Algeria FinLab as a catalyst for innovation and transformation.
